Concrete leveling services involve the process of restoring a sunken or uneven concrete surface to its proper height and smoothness. Over time, concrete slabs can settle due to soil movement, erosion, or poor initial installation, leading to cracks, unevenness, and potential safety hazards. Service providers typically use specialized materials and techniques to lift and stabilize the concrete, ensuring a level surface that improves both appearance and functionality. This process is often less invasive and more cost-effective than replacing the entire slab, making it a practical solution for many property owners.

This service helps address common problems such as trip hazards caused by uneven walkways, cracked driveways, and uneven garage floors. These issues not only diminish curb appeal but can also pose safety risks for residents and visitors. Concrete leveling can also help prevent further damage by stabilizing the slab and reducing stress on the surrounding structure. Property owners who notice their concrete surfaces sinking or cracking may find that leveling restores safety, enhances the property's look, and helps avoid more costly repairs down the line.

What is concrete leveling? Concrete leveling is a process that restores the evenness of sunken or uneven concrete slabs by raising and stabilizing them, often using specialized techniques and materials.

How do local contractors perform concrete leveling? Contractors typically use methods like mudjacking or foam injection to lift and level concrete surfaces, ensuring a smooth and stable finish.

Is concrete leveling suitable for all types of concrete surfaces? Concrete leveling is most effective on driveways, sidewalks, patios, and slabs that have settled or shifted, but a professional assessment is recommended for each specific situation.

Can concrete leveling prevent further damage? Yes, properly performed leveling can help prevent additional cracking or sinking by stabilizing the surface and reducing stress on the concrete.

What are common signs that concrete needs leveling? Signs include uneven surfaces, noticeable cracks, and areas that feel sunken or tilted, which may indicate the need for professional leveling services.
